δ-La(BO2)3 (≡δ-LaB3O6): A new high-pressure modification of lanthanum meta-oxoborate
چکیده انگلیسی

The δ modification of lanthanum meta-oxoborate was discovered during our systematic investigations in the field of oxoborates, synthesized under high-pressure conditions. δ-La(BO2)3 (≡δ-LaB3O6) was obtained at high-pressure (5.5 GPa) and high-temperature (1050 °C) in a Walker  -type multianvil apparatus. The monoclinic compound crystallizes with four formula units in the space group P21/cP21/c, exhibiting lattice parameters of a=424.1(1)a=424.1(1), b=1171.2(2)b=1171.2(2), c=731.1(2) pmc=731.1(2) pm, and β=91.2(1)°β=91.2(1)°. Due to the synthesis under high-pressure conditions, the structure exhibits [BO4]5− tetrahedra exclusively, which are connected via common corners. Additionally, 1/6 of the oxygen atoms are bridging three boron atoms (O[3]), leading to a network structure with ten-membered rings of [BO4]5− tetrahedra (d(BO)=144–155 pmd(BO)=144–155 pm), in which the La3+ ions are coordinated by twelve oxygen atoms (d(LaO)=245–332 pmd(LaO)=245–332 pm). After a discussion of the structure, infrared and temperature-dependent X-ray powder diffraction data are presented.
